Ingredients
– 2 cups cooked and shredded chicken
– 1/2 cup BBQ sauce (your choice of flavor)
– 8 slices of bread (your choice, such as sourdough or whole grain)
– 2 cups shredded cheese (cheddar, mozzarella, or a blend)
– Butter, for spreading
– Optional toppings: sliced pickles, jalapeños, or red onions
Instructions
Making BBQ Chicken Grilled Cheese is straightforward if you follow these simple steps:
1. Prepare the Chicken: In a medium bowl, mix the shredded chicken with the BBQ sauce until well coated.
2. Preheat the Pan: Set a large skillet over medium heat and allow it to warm up while you assemble the sandwiches.
3. Assemble the Sandwich: Take one slice of bread, butter one side, and place it butter-side down in the skillet. Layer with a generous portion of cheese, followed by the BBQ chicken mixture, and top with more cheese.
4. Add the Top Slice: Place another slice of bread on top (butter-side up).
5. Cook and Toast: Let the sandwich cook for about 4-5 minutes until the bottom is golden brown. Carefully flip it over with a spatula and cook the other side for a similar time until the cheese is melted and both sides are crispy.
6. Repeat: If making more sandwiches, continue the process until all are prepared.
7. Slice and Serve: Once each sandwich is cooked, remove it from the skillet, let it cool slightly, and slice it in half to reveal the melty goodness inside.
